Panama: Ally of Convicted Former President Wins Election

May 6, 2024 | 17:09 GMT

Panamanian presidential candidate Jose Raul Mulino of the conservative Realizing Goals party won Panama's May 5 election with nearly 35% of the vote and a 9% lead on the next closest candidate, anti-corruption candidate Ricardo Lombana, according to unofficial results issued by Panamanian authorities, AP reported on May 6....
